Perguntas com a marcação «path-finding»

Problemas na geometria ou na teoria dos grafos que envolvem encontrar um caminho ótimo (por exemplo, o mais curto), sujeito a restrições (obstáculos).

58
Minha prisão está segura?

Seu desafio recebe uma entrada de um layout da prisão para determinar se algum dos presos pode escapar. Entrada A entrada pode estar em qualquer formato razoável, como uma sequência, matriz, matriz de matrizes etc. A entrada será composta por três caracteres, neste caso #, Pe espaço. A entrada...

52
Robô encontra gatinho

O desafio O menor código por contagem de caracteres para ajudar o Robot a encontrar o gatinho com o menor número de etapas possível. Golfistas, este é um momento de crise - Kitten desapareceu e é trabalho do Robot encontrá-lo! O robô precisa alcançar o Kitten no caminho mais curto possível. No...

51
Anexando comprimentos de string

Desafio: Dada uma sequência snos caracteres a- z, A- Z, 0- 9, acrescente o comprimento de ssi mesmo, contando os caracteres adicionais no comprimento como parte do comprimento total de s. Entrada: Apenas uma sequência de comprimento arbitrário (pode estar vazio). Resultado: A mesma sequência,...

46
Fechadura de bicicleta combinada

O cenário Depois de um longo dia de trabalho andando no escritório e navegando pelo stackexchange.com , finalmente saio pela porta às 16:58, já cansada com o dia. Como ainda sou apenas estagiário, meu modo de transporte atual é de bicicleta. Dirijo-me ao meu fiel Peugeot Reynolds 501 , mas antes...

43
Island Golf # 1: Circunavegação

Este é o primeiro de uma série de desafios do Island Golf. Próximo desafio Dada uma ilha na arte ASCII, produza um caminho ideal para contorná-la. Entrada Sua entrada será uma grade retangular composta por dois caracteres, representando terra e água. Nos exemplos abaixo, a terra é #e a água é .,...

43
Construir a matriz de identidade

O desafio é muito simples. Dada uma entrada inteira n, produza a n x nmatriz de identidade. A matriz de identidade é aquela que se 1estende da parte superior esquerda até a parte inferior direita. Você escreverá um programa ou uma função que retornará ou produzirá a matriz de identidade que você...

41
Esse número é uma potência inteira de -2?

Existem maneiras inteligentes de determinar se um número é uma potência de 2. Isso não é mais um problema interessante, então vamos determinar se um número inteiro é uma potência de -2 . Por exemplo: -2 => yes: (-2)¹ -1 => no 0 => no 1 => yes: (-2)⁰ 2 => no 3 => no 4 => yes:...

39
Pi Natural # 0 - Rocha

Objetivo Crie um programa / função que receba uma entrada N, verifique se Npares aleatórios de números inteiros são relativamente primos e retorne sqrt(6 * N / #coprime). TL; DR Esses desafios são simulações de algoritmos que exigem apenas a natureza e seu cérebro (e talvez alguns recursos...

36
Programe um carro de corrida

PARABÉNS a @kuroineko. Ganha a recompensa por uma velocidade excelente (672 movimentos) na pista de Gauntlet. LÍDER: * Nimi com 2129 leve. Outras entradas são maiores, mas mostram uma certa velocidade. * O líder pode mudar devido a entradas posteriores. Sua tarefa é escrever um pequeno programa...

34
Desbloqueie seu bloqueio

Você bloqueou sua bicicleta com uma trava combinada de 3 dígitos. Agora você quer dar um passeio e precisa desbloqueá-lo com a ajuda do programa a seguir. Entrada 1º parâmetro A combinação de dígitos do seu bloqueio no estado bloqueado . Ele deve ser diferente do segundo parâmetro (= a...

33
Este é o número Loeschian?

Um número inteiro positivo ké um número Loeschiano se kpode ser expressa como i*i + j*j + i*jpara i, jinteiros. Por exemplo, os primeiros números loeschianos positivos são: 1( i=1, j=0); 3( i=j=1); 4( i=2, j=0); 7( i=2, j=1); 9( i=-3, j=3); ... Observe que i, jpara um dado, knão são únicos. Por...

32
Office Escape: planeje sua saída!

É o sprint final ... e metade do seu time está doente. Você está trabalhando até tarde, apenas fazendo sua última confirmação do dia, esperando ... por que as luzes se apagaram? Não me lembro do cara da segurança por aí ... oh não! Deixei minhas chaves em casa! À medida que o horror da situação...

32
Rotina olímpica de balançar as videiras de Tarzan

As videiras olímpicas realizam suas rotinas em árvores comuns. Em particular, a Árvore Padrão npossui vértices para 0cima n-1e arestas que vinculam cada vértice diferente de zero aao vértice n % aabaixo dele. Então, por exemplo, a Árvore Padrão 5 se parece com isso: 3 | 2 4 \ / 1 | 0 porque...

31
Maior cadeia de dominó

Descrição do Desafio Dominó é um jogo jogado com peças com dois valores: um à esquerda, outro à direita, por exemplo [2|4]ou [4|5]. Duas peças podem ser unidas se elas contiverem um valor comum. Os dois blocos acima podem ser unidos assim: [2|4][4|5] Vamos chamar uma sequência de nblocos unidos...